Swanbourne Road is in Sheffield and in Sheffield district. S5 7TL is located in the Firth Park elect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Sheffield, Brightside and Hillsborough.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ding S5 7TL,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 52.7%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around S5 7TL,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 47.2%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Safety

Is Swanbourne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Swanbourne Road was 384.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 214.7% higher than the Firth Park average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Swanbourne Road has the 7th highest crime rate of 102 local areas in Firth Park and the 82nd highest crime rate of 1,697 local areas in Sheffield .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 182.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 6.9%.
